Tottenham Hotspur began their Premier League season with a 3-0 defeat against Brentford at the Gtech Community Stadium on August 22, 2026. Early goals from Keane Lewis-Potter and Vitaly Janelt set the tone for Brentford, with Michael Kayode adding a third shortly after halftime. Tottenham, having significantly invested £237 million in new signings this summer, failed to register a shot on target in the first half, highlighting their struggles. Brentford's dominant performance came despite missing a penalty in the second half. The loss emphasizes Tottenham's ongoing difficulties, having narrowly avoided relegation last season.
